Understanding the Container Revolution

International PHP Conference via YouTube

Overview

This course aims to provide an understanding of the container revolution by exploring the history and significance of container technology beyond Docker. The course covers topics such as container security, Linux namespaces, Docker as a virtual machine alternative, Continuous Delivery, Infrastructure as Code, and the impact of containers on software delivery processes. The intended audience for this course includes software developers, DevOps engineers, system administrators, and anyone interested in modern software delivery practices. The teaching method involves a lecture format with a focus on theoretical concepts and practical implications of container technology.
